#1 – A No-Compromise Approach to Power
Nissan does something that no other non-domestic automaker does in the truck segment: it matches American-built trucks toe-for-toe in terms of power. The Titan is the only non-domestic truck to offer an eight-cylinder powerplant. It doesn’t just compete with the likes of Chevrolet, Ford, and Ram. Instead, it excels and sets new standards of excellence.
You’ll see this on the 2023 Titan, which offers the most standard horsepower in the class, and many other Certified Pre-Owned Titan models. This class-leading capability is courtesy of the Titan’s 5.6L Endurance V8 engine and nine-speed automatic transmission. The transmission’s wide gear range makes full use of the engine’s 400 hp and 413 lb-ft of torque for outstanding responsiveness, off-the-line acceleration, and handling. This combination has been offered since the 2020 Titan, making it an easy find when you shop CPO.
You won’t find any other truck in the segment to offer this level of performance standard, giving the Titan a definite advantage and every opportunity to live up to its namesake. #2 – The Most Safety Features in the Segment
Nissan is renowned for its no-compromise approach to safety, with many models offering the most standard safety features in their respective segments. The Titan is no exception. Nissan’s illustrious workhorse delivers peace of mind as a Certified Pre-Owned model courtesy of the Nissan Safety Shield 360 suite. This driver-assist suite includes High Beam Assist, Rear Automatic Braking, Blind Spot Warning, Lane Departure Warning, Rear Cross Traffic Alert, and Automatic Emergency Braking with Pedestrian Detection.
The Titan takes safety one step further by including class-exclusive features like Intelligent Forward Collision Warning and available technology like the Intelligent Around View Monitor, Intelligent Driver Alertness, Intelligent Cruise Control, and Traffic Sign Recognition. Nissan’s Forward Collision Warning actively monitors ahead of the truck for potential collisions and uses Automatic Emergency Braking with Pedestrian Detection to optimize your safety. Meanwhile, Nissan’s Intelligent Cruise Control transforms your driving experience by watching the flow of traffic and adjusting the Titan’s cruising speed as needed with no input from you.

#4 – A High-Value Lineup
The Titan takes a unique approach, with Nissan fine tuning its lineup while other manufacturers err on the side of excess and overwhelm. This streamlined approach eliminates confusion by offering high-value packages across the board. Instead of choosing from several powertrains and layouts, Nissan makes things simple with a standard V8 and lets you focus on other aspects like comfort, technology, and features.
For example, you’ll typically find a Certified Pre-Owned Titan as a King Cab or Crew Cab with or without four-wheel drive. The Crew Cab offers a standard 5.5-foot bed, with the King Cab boasting a 6.5-foot bed. In addition, the available trims offer a progressive suite of features and amenities, giving each trim a distinct appeal to different drivers. At the same time, the standard V8 engine guarantees ample power across the lineup and promises a maximum towing capacity of over 9,300 lbs and a maximum payload of nearly 1,700 lbs.
#5 – The Capable and Adventurous PRO-4X
Nissan makes it easy to answer the call of the wild with options like the Titan PRO-4X. Destined for the trail, the off-road-oriented PRO-4X comes straight from the factory with all-terrain tires, four-wheel drive, Bilstein off-road shock absorbers, skid plates, and an electronic locking rear differential. The PRO-4X also adds Hill Descent Control and trim-exclusive design details like a black grille with a Lava Red Nissan badge, a black tailgate finisher, and unique badging. #7 – The Option to Go Heavy-Duty
The Titan offers the most standard horsepower in its class, but sometimes that isn’t enough. Drivers often need more, and that’s where the Titan XD shines. This heavy-duty variant takes everything you love about the Titan and transforms it into a real workhorse with a 6.5-foot bed, a longer 151.6-inch wheelbase, and a fully boxed, full-length ladder frame for improved strength and rigidity. The result is remarkable, giving the Titan XD a larger footprint than the Titan and advanced capability, with over 11,000 lbs of towing capacity and over 2,200 lbs of payload capacity.
#8 – Built in America
Nissan may not call America home, but the automaker has done wonders to design its lineup to meet the needs of American drivers. We see this with the Titan’s versatility and capability, and it’s also apparent in where this truck is built. Many Americans are passionate about investing in American-made products, and the Titan answers that demand. Every Certified Pre-Owned Titan was assembled at Nissan’s Mississippi plant, with its renowned V8 engine sourced straight from the automaker’s powertrain plant in Tennessee.

#9 – Carry Every Type of Cargo
The Titan is one of the most versatile trucks in the industry because it acknowledges that every driver has different needs. For example, while one driver may use their Titan to haul tools in the backseat, another makes the most out of the Titan’s large bed by loading it with equipment, furniture, lumber, and other bulky items. In either instance, Nissan makes hauling cargo easy with the Titan’s functional design.
The Titan Boxes are an available option that can enhance the truck’s bed. These dual storage boxes are built into the sides of the bed, are lockable, and can easily store essential tools and other small equipment. The Titan Boxes add to the truck’s work-ready design, which includes a dampened tailgate on newer models, a 120-volt bed power outlet, and a durable spray-in bed liner designed to withstand the elements.
